MISHAP
MAORI SUSTAINS BROKEN WRIST When the car engine he was endeavouring to start by the use of the carnlc handle backfired, Kahn Tilii, of Ruatoki, sustained a fracture of the right wrist. He was admitted to the Whakatane hospital.
